Which player most inspired you and why? Ronaldinho. Because of his technique and understanding of the game
Which coach most inspired you? Both Jesper Petersen and Peer Lisdorf.
What was the best advice they gave you? They taught me to believe in myself and said that I should set myself goals and go after them.
Best player you've played with? Julie Rydahl.
Toughest opponent? Turbine Potsdam.
What are your memories of your first club as a child? We were the leading team and we had a great team spirit.
What tip would you give a young player hoping to succeed? You must be dedicated, committed and trust in yourself.
